About Sierra Space
Sierra Space is a commercial space infrastructure company headquartered in Louisville, Colorado, founded in 2021 as a spinoff of Sierra Nevada Corporation's space business unit. The company operates at the intersection of spacecraft systems, commercial space stations, and in-space manufacturing, targeting the emerging low-Earth orbit (LEO) economy. Its flagship asset is the Dream Chaser spaceplane — a reusable, multi-mission orbital vehicle designed to transport cargo (and eventually crew) to the International Space Station and future commercial destinations. Dream Chaser is the only winged commercial spacecraft under NASA contract, holding a Commercial Resupply Services 2 (CRS-2) agreement that includes at least six cargo missions to the ISS.

Sierra Space's second major program is the LIFE (Large Integrated Flexible Environment) habitat, an inflatable space station module engineered to expand to 300 cubic meters on orbit — roughly the size of a nine-story building when compressed for launch. LIFE habitats are the structural building blocks of Orbital Reef, a commercial space station Sierra Space is co-developing with Blue Origin, Boeing, Redwire, and Genesis Engineering Solutions under a NASA Commercial Low Earth Orbit Destinations (CLD) award. Orbital Reef is designed to succeed the ISS as a hub for research, manufacturing, tourism, and national lab activities in orbit.

Sierra Space raised over $1.4B in a landmark Series A round in 2021, valuing the company at $4.5B, with investors including General Atlantic, Coatue Management, Moore Strategic Ventures, and AE Industrial Partners. The company employs over 2,000 people across facilities in Louisville, Broomfield, and Madison. Its commercial model spans government contracts (NASA, DoD), international space agencies, and private customers seeking affordable access to orbit — positioning Sierra Space as a vertically integrated commercial space infrastructure provider competing with Northrop Grumman, SpaceX, and Axiom Space.
